Hey guys, Im a new and recent fz6 owner (2006 fz6). I bought the bike used from some guy, only has 7000 miles on it. the only thing with the bike is:

1) there is some wierd modulator for my tail light, it makes a wierd and random circle pattern when riding and then blinks when I hit my brakes. On top of that, it isn't the brightest in the world.

2) another thing is, that there seems to be these cheap-o wannabe carbon fiber blinkers in the front and one (the right one) doesn't work. I was also wondering how easy it is to replace those kind of things as well.

3) lastly, my right rear turn signal blinks at a faster speed then my left one (about twice the speed, if that matters), is this due to the previous owner messing with the modulator or something? how can I correct that?

1) This sounds like one of those spinning 1157 bulbs - they spin when in idle mode, flash when brake is applied and they're directional LEDs so not very bright at most angles. You can pop the tail light bulb out pretty easy with the seat off and check. A 2-pack of the normal bulbs is usually around $2 at any gas station although they don't last as long as the Yamaha one.

2) A picture would help - there's a lot of cheapo carbon fiber blinkers out there - most have a stud that goes through the bracket with a nut on the opposite side and are pretty much disposable unless they use incandescent bulbs in which case you might be able to find a replacement.

3.) This is because your front right signal is out - it's the flasher's way of letting you know there's a blinker problem. Once you get the front one fixed, the rate should be the same for both sides.

I've never installed one of the integrated lights but I don't think they're that involved - looks like most will plug into your stock brake socket and splice into your signal lines.
